"GOOD MORNING!!! The Mixtape Vol. 3 *EER'LEE!!!* " - SONNY LEWIS: Reviewed by Rex Stone

THE GOOD:
So I think I was feeling this CD from the very first song but being a true reviewer/critic I knew that I had to listen to the whole thing from beginning to end. I got what the artist was going for and I think that he pulled it off in amazing fashion. Hats off to Sonny Lewis for making a mix tape that fans and artists can be proud of. In his own words, He definitely, “separates the spitters from the bullshitters,” and is “head of the class” if not the teacher. My personal picks are “Music,” “Can’t Be Mad,” “What Type Are You” and “The Oath.” I think he is a true emcee and lyricist. No matter his genre of hip-hop, Sonny is a voice that people should look out for.
THE BAD:
Despite the fact that he can flow on the microphone; it does not hide the fact that it is monotone and the same on every track. He might want to try and change up his flow every once in a while when he does different kinds of beats, especially on those R&B tracks. When you are recording you need to check your volumes, step back from the mic, or get a good filter. I think that he has a lot to offer as a rapper but he should be a beast on every song, going for his and not letting the track overshadow his voice.
THE TRUTH:
I actually like this mixtape better than a lot that I have listened to on outhiphop.com. I do think that Sonny should make every song a full song with a verse, chorus, bridge, etc. I want a real record from this artist. Even though I felt the emotions poured out on this mix-tape from having a good time to going through some very emotional things in life, at one point near the end I thought that he was going to cry. He held his own with the other rappers that he collaborated with on the CD but he shouldn’t let them outshine him. He has everything he needs to be the person that represents this gay rap thing, and just needs to build upon it and make it better.
THE RECOMMENDATION:
Mash It, Download It, Play It, Love It! A True Mix-Tape for the Movement!
